How to Decorate a Black T-Shirt

If you bought a black T-shirt to decorate, you may be wondering what types of garnishments will show up the best. You could use glow-in-the-dark fabric paints, silver or white acrylic paints and add textile medium, or even sparkly white iron-on letters. Once you decide what design you want on it, you are set and ready to start decorating!

Things You'll Need

  • Black T-shirt
  • Cardboard piece to fit inside T-shirt
  • Fabric paints or acrylic paints with textile medium added
  • Decal letters or pictures
  • Iron
  • Picture to copy design (optional)

Instructions

  1. Making Black T-Shirt Masterpieces

    • 1

      Wash the black T-shirt if it is brand-new. Do not use fabric softener, but you can dry it in the dryer. If the T-shirt is used, then you do not need to wash it first.

    • 2

      Place the piece of cardboard in between the front and the back of the shirt. This keeps fabric paint from seeping through and creating unwanted marks on the back of the shirt. Read the directions on your paint containers carefully before decorating your black T-shirt. You will also want to pay attention to washing instructions to make sure your hard work does not come off in the washing machine.

    • 3

      Choose what type of design you are planning to use for the t-shirt. If you are not an artist, you can use pictures from wall decorations, clip art on the computer, or even coloring books. Some people will also use stencils if they are not good at drawing.

    • 4

      Use light, fluorescent, or glow-in-the-dark colors on black T-shirts to make sure that the paint shows up better. Create your design with the paints, and check that the cardboard is catching any excess paint, and it's not bleeding through.

    • 5

      Use iron-on decals to finish your shirt decorations if you want to add anything else. Iron-on letters are often useful because they are easy to put in a straight line. Again, you will want to use decals that are white, silver, or sparkly, so they stand out against the black material.

Tips & Warnings

  • You can use acrylic paints instead of fabric paints. You have to add textile medium to the acrylic paint before you use it on the T-shirt. Textile medium keeps the paint from cracking and breaking on the material.
